Very Juicy Chicken Karaage

cookpad.japan
cookpad.japan @cookpad_jp

I wanted to make delicious karaage fried chicken and became obsessed with this flavoring, coating, and frying method.

The first time you deep-fry the chicken should just be for 1-2 minutes. Let the chicken cook through with the residual heat and fry a second time. This traps in the moisture so that the chicken doesn't dry out, and makes them crispy. It takes some time but this karaage is definitely delicious.
If you substitute the flour for potato starch, use half the amount. Recipe by *Anna*

Ingredients

3 servings
  1. 450 gramsChicken thighs
  2. 3 tbsp* Soy sauce
  3. 1 tbsp* Mayonnaise
  4. 1 tbsp* Sake
  5. 1/2 tbsp* Sesame oil
  6. 2 1/2 tsp* Grated ginger
  7. 2 1/2 tsp* Grated garlic
  8. 200 ml☆ Flour
  9. 1☆ Egg
  10. 4 tbsp☆ Water
  11. 1☆ Salt
  12. 1☆ Black pepper
  13. 1☆ All Spice (optional)
  14. 1Frying oil

Steps

  1. 1

    Cut the chicken thigh into bite-sized pieces.

    A picture of step 1 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  2. 2

    Combine the * ingredients and add to Step 1. Quickly massage the mixture into the meat, and if possible, let it marinate for a while. I let it marinate for about 3 hours.

    A picture of step 2 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  3. 3

    Combine the ☆ ingredients.

    A picture of step 3 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  4. 4

    Add just the chicken (leave the marinade) from Step 2 into the mixture from Step 3 and stir.

    A picture of step 4 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  5. 5

    Heat some oil over medium heat. Add the Step 4 meat coated in the mixture to the frying pan with your hand. Deep-fry for 1-2 minutes and remove it. Let it rest on a paper towel. Let the residual heat cook the meat through.

    A picture of step 5 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  6. 6

    After some time, raise the oil temperature to high, and use long cooking chopsticks to add the meat and stir it around while deep-frying, until a nicely browned color. Then it's done.

    A picture of step 6 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  7. 7

    The outside is crisp and the center is juicy.

    A picture of step 7 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  8. 8

    After Step 4, if you mix flour and katakuriko at a ratio of 1:1 and coat the chicken, it will turn out even crispier and crunchier.

    A picture of step 8 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
  9. 9

    For those of you who like karaage crisp and crunchy, if you have the time you should definitely try this method.

    A picture of step 9 of Very Juicy Chicken Karaage.
